svn的一些使用理解

SVN工具使用

Svn是一种集中式文件版本管理系统。集中式代码管理的核心是服务器,所有开发者在开始新一天的工作之前必须从服务器获取代码,然后开发,最后解决冲突,提交。

集中式文件版本管理系统:将所有的文件都交由服务器来进行统一的管理。既然是有服务器的,那么就需要联网进行操作了。

为什么要使用SVN
我们写一个项目一般都是一个团队来写,如果我们没有用SVN的话,那么我们只能在团队中互相拷贝对方的代码来完成我们的项目。

SVN还有如下的好处:
1、轻松比较不同版本间的细微差别【修改了代码,就有版本号,还能知道修改前后的数据】
2、及时了解团队中其他成员的进度【如果没有把代码提交到服务器中,就是做得比较慢了】
3、广域网共享【连上局域网就可以代码共享了】
4、协同工作,大大提高团队工作效率

SVN配置库

它储存所有的数据,配置库按照文件树形式储存数据

包括目录和文件

SVN命令

—创建服务器端版本库
svnadmin create 版本库路径
—启动SVN服务器端
svnserve -d -r 版本库路径
—删除系统服务中的 服务
sc delete 服务ID
常见的子命令
import:将未纳入版本控制器的文件或目录提交到版本库中(仅执行一次)
checkout: 从版本库标签中出工作副本
revert:将工作副本文件恢复到指定版本
update: 将版本库的修改合并到工作副本中
commit:把工作副本的修改提交到版本库。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

归途风景111

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值